Week 6
Welcome to the sixth week of the course!
Main topic of this week: Ontology Matching
Learning outcomes of this week
After completing this week successfully, the students are capable of:
- Explaining what ontology matching is and why it is important
- Discussing practical and methodological issues
- Describing different techniques for ontology matching
- Evaluating the quality of ontology matching
Learning activities of this week
[22/03 10:45 - 12:30] Lecture 6: Ontology Matching
[25/03 13:45 - 17:30] Practical session 6: Ontology Matching
Self-learning materials
[1] Euzenat Jérôme, & Shvaiko, P. (2013). Ontology matching (2nd ed.). Springer Berlin Heidelberg.
- Chapter 2. The Matching Problem
- Chapter 4. Classifications of Ontology Matching Techniques
- Chapter 9. Evaluation of Matching Systems
Complementary
[2] Castano S., Ferrara A., Montanelli S., Varese G. (2011) Ontology and Instance Matching. In: Paliouras G., Spyropoulos C.D., Tsatsaronis G. (eds) Knowledge-Driven Multimedia Information Extraction and Ontology Evolution. Lecture Notes in Computer Science, vol 6050. Springer, Berlin, Heidelberg.
[3] Peter Ochieng and Swaib Kyanda. 2018. Large-Scale Ontology Matching: State-of-the-Art Analysis. ACM Computing Surveys. 51, 4, Article 75 (July 2019), 35 pages. DOI: https://doi.org/10.1145/3211871
[4] ontologymatching.org provides a repository of information devoted to different aspects of ontology matching.
[5] Ontology Alignment Evaluation Initiative (OAEI) organises evaluation campaigns aiming at evaluating ontology matching technologies since 2004.
[5] OpenHPI Tutorials - 5.4 Ontology Alignment
[6] VU Amsterdam course - Module 5.2 Ontology Matching